What is varicose veins
and when to consult vascular surgeon

Varicose veins are swollen, twisted veins that can occur anywhere in the body, but are most common in the legs. If left untreated, varicose veins can cause discomfort, pain, and even serious health problems like blood clots and skin ulcers.A vascular surgeon is a medical specialist who is trained to diagnose and treat conditions related to the circulatory system, including varicose veins.

The treatment of varicose veins by a vascular surgeon typically involves the following steps:

Evaluation:

The vascular surgeon will first evaluate the patient’s condition and medical history to determine the severity of the varicose veins and any underlying health issues that may be contributing to the problem.

Diagnostic tests:

The surgeon may order diagnostic tests, such as ultrasound or venography, to get a more detailed view of the veins and blood flow in the affected area.

Non-surgical treatments:

In mild cases, the surgeon may recommend non-surgical treatments like compression stockings, exercise, and lifestyle changes to alleviate symptoms and prevent further complications.

Minimally invasive procedures:

If non-surgical treatments are not effective, the surgeon may recommend minimally invasive procedures like endovenous laser treatment (EVLT), radiofrequency ablation (RFA), or sclerotherapy. These procedures involve using heat or a chemical solution to seal off or shrink the affected veins.

Surgery:

In severe cases, surgery may be necessary to remove the affected veins. The most common surgical procedure for varicose veins is vein stripping, which involves removing the vein through small incisions in the leg.

After treatment, the patient may be advised to wear compression stockings and make lifestyle changes to help prevent the recurrence of varicose veins. The recovery time and specific recommendations will vary depending on the type and severity of the treatment.

Why vascular surgeon should treat varicose veins

Varicose veins are a common problem affecting millions of people worldwide. They can be unsightly and uncomfortable, but in severe cases, they can also lead to serious health complications. For this reason, it is important that varicose veins are treated by a vascular surgeon, who is trained and specialized in the diagnosis and treatment of vascular conditions.

Varicose veins are enlarged, twisted veins that can occur anywhere in the body but are most commonly found in the legs. They are caused by a weakening of the vein walls or valves, which can result in blood pooling in the veins. This can lead to a range of symptoms, including pain, swelling, and aching.

While many people may seek treatment for varicose veins from their primary care physician or a dermatologist, it is important to consult with a vascular surgeon for the following reasons:

Specialised expertise:

Vascular surgeons are trained to diagnose and treat a range of vascular conditions, including varicose veins. They have specialised knowledge and skills that enable them to provide the most effective treatment options and minimise the risk of complications.

Advanced diagnostic tools:

Vascular surgeons have access to advanced diagnostic tools, such as ultrasound and venography, which can help them to accurately diagnose the extent of the problem and determine the most appropriate treatment options.

Minimally invasive treatment options:

Vascular surgeons are skilled in performing minimally invasive procedures, such as endovenous laser treatment (EVLT) and radiofrequency ablation (RFA), which can effectively treat varicose veins without the need for surgery.

Surgical expertise:

In cases where surgery is necessary, vascular surgeons have the surgical expertise and experience to perform procedures such as vein stripping and phlebectomy to remove the affected veins.

Comprehensive care:

Vascular surgeons are able to provide comprehensive care for patients with varicose veins, including ongoing monitoring and follow-up care to ensure the best possible outcomes.
